About this tag
The family safety bug tag covers a specific issue where Microsoft Family Safety prevents Google Chrome from launching or causes it to crash on children's Windows accounts. This bug, reported in 2025, affects parents who use Family Safety for parental controls but prefer Chrome over Microsoft Edge. The problem manifests as Chrome closing immediately after opening, often without error messages. Discussions include user reports, technical analysis, and potential fixes. The tag focuses on this conflict between Microsoft's safety feature and Chrome, highlighting troubleshooting steps and community experiences.
